Known as the Napa, California of Chile, Colchagua is home to some of the greatest Chilean wineries and real estate. Vina La Playa is a 22 acre resort, with 7 acres devoted to vineyards, located in the Colchagua Valley which has seen rapid growth including museums, a wine train, a casino, and the best windsurfing beaches in Chile. The Chilean style hacienda is a 2 story, 11 bedroom estate with a full on dinning room and servants quarters. The hacienda is 2 and a half hours outside of Santiago and is situated among other vineyards near the Tinguiriricia riverbank.

So what makes this hacieda style winery even more special? How about a full size pool, helicopter pad, and bike paths. Lots of pictures and pricing after the jump. Though the property has been used as a resort, it could be easily converted into your next estate. The Vina La Playa is listed for $1.7 million; a deal in our book.
